首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么Dictionary.map返回一个元组数组,它的文档记录在哪里?

Dictionary.map返回一个元组数组的原因是因为Dictionary.map方法是用于对字典进行映射操作的,它会遍历字典中的每个键值对,并将每个键值对映射为一个元组,然后将这些元组组成一个数组返回。

关于Dictionary.map方法的文档记录可以在腾讯云的文档中找到。腾讯云提供了一套完善的文档,其中包含了各种云计算相关的知识和技术文档。在腾讯云的文档中,可以找到Dictionary.map方法的详细介绍、使用示例、参数说明、返回值说明等内容。可以通过访问腾讯云的官方网站,进入文档页面,然后搜索Dictionary.map方法来查找相关文档记录。

腾讯云相关产品和产品介绍链接地址:

请注意,以上提供的链接地址仅为示例,实际使用时请根据实际情况进行访问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python工程师面试必备25条Python知识点

以及哪里不好。 2.什么是PEP8? PEP8是一个编程规范,内容是一些关于如何让你程序更具可读性建议。 其主要内容包括代码编排、文档编排、空格使用、注释、文档描述、命名规范、编码建议等。...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8.数组元组之间区别是什么? 数组元组之间区别:数组内容是可以被修改,而元组内容是只读。...匿名函数lambda没有语句原因,是它被用于代码被执行时候构建新函数对象并且返回。 15.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 19.Python中什么是构造器? 生成器是实现迭代器一种机制。...24.Xrange和range区别是什么? Xrange用于返回一个xrange对象,而range用于返回一个数组。不管那个范围多大,Xrange都使用同样内存。

1.1K60

Python工程师面试汇总:25条Python知识点,命中高达95%

以及哪里不好。 2.什么是PEP8? PEP8是一个编程规范,内容是一些关于如何让你程序更具可读性建议。 其主要内容包括代码编排、文档编排、空格使用、注释、文档描述、命名规范、编码建议等。...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8.数组元组之间区别是什么? 数组元组之间区别:数组内容是可以被修改,而元组内容是只读。...匿名函数lambda没有语句原因,是它被用于代码被执行时候构建新函数对象并且返回。 15.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 19.Python中什么是构造器? 生成器是实现迭代器一种机制。...24.Xrange和range区别是什么? Xrange用于返回一个xrange对象,而range用于返回一个数组。不管那个范围多大,Xrange都使用同样内存。

1K31
  • 王老板Python面试(6):25道Python工程师面试必备知识点!

    以及哪里不好。 2 什么是PEP8? PEP8是一个编程规范,内容是一些关于如何让你程序更具可读性建议。 其主要内容包括代码编排、文档编排、空格使用、注释、文档描述、命名规范、编码建议等。...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8 数组元组之间区别是什么? 数组元组之间区别:数组内容是可以被修改,而元组内容是只读。...匿名函数lambda没有语句原因,是它被用于代码被执行时候构建新函数对象并且返回。 15 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 19 Python中什么是构造器? 生成器是实现迭代器一种机制。...24 Xrange和range区别是什么? Xrange用于返回一个xrange对象,而range用于返回一个数组。不管那个范围多大,Xrange都使用同样内存。

    77510

    100 个基本 Python 面试问题第四部分(81-100)

    回到目录 ---- Q-89:Python 中文档字符串用途是什么? Python 中,文档字符串就是我们所说文档字符串。设置了记录 Python 函数、模块和类过程。...工作原理类似于标准 return 关键字。但它总是会返回一个生成器对象。此外,一个方法可以多次调用yield 关键字。 请参阅下面的示例。...字典中,每一项都代表一个键值对。因此,转换列表并不像转换其他数据类型那样简单。 但是,我们可以通过将列表分成一组对,然后调用zip() 函数将它们作为元组返回来实现转换。...与集合不同,列表可以包含具有相同值项目。 Python 中,列表有一个count() 函数,返回特定项目的出现次数。 计算单个项目的出现次数。...NumPy 是一个用于科学计算 Python 包,可以处理大数据量。包括一个强大 N 维数组对象和一组高级函数。 此外,NumPy 数组优于内置列表。 NumPy 数组比列表更紧凑。

    3.6K31

    spark——Pair rdd用法,基本上都在这了

    毕竟我们value不一定就是一个数组,这就要说到我们传入函数了,这个flatMap操作其实是针对函数返回结果,也就是说函数会返回一个迭代器,然后打散内容其实是这个迭代器当中值。...最后一个函数是将D进行合并,所以它可以写成是(D, D) => D。 到这里我们看似好像明白了原理,但是又好像有很多问号,总觉得哪里有些不太对劲。...我想了很久,才找到了问题根源,出在哪里呢,在于合并。有没有发现第二个函数和第三个函数都是用来合并为什么我们要合并两次,它们之间区别是什么?...首先,我们第一个函数将value转化成了(1, value)元组元组第0号元素表示出现该单词文档数,第1号元素表示文档内出现次数。...比如apple一个分区内出现在了两个文档内,一共出现了20次,一个分区出现在了三个文档中,一共出现了30次,那么显然我们一共出现在了5个文档中,一共出现了50次。

    1.5K30

    【拓展】未来JavaScript记录元组

    (Record),是不可修改按值比较对象 元组(Tuple),是不可修改按值比较数组 什么是按值比较 当前,JavaScript只有比较原始值(如字符串)时才会按值比较(比较内容): > '...而记录一个按值比较复合值,且不可修改: > #{x: 1, y: 4} === #{x: 1, y: 4}true 如果在数组字面量前面加一个#,就可以创建一个元组,也就是可以按值比较且不可修改数组...这就是为什么JavaScript中可以用作键值: 要么按值比较且不可修改(原始值) 要么按标识比较且可修改(对象) 复合原始值好处 复合原始值有如下好处。...深度比较对象,这是一个内置操作,可以通过如===来调用。 共享值:如果对象是可修改,为了安全共享就需要深度复制一个副本。而对于不可修改值,就可以直接共享。...JSON.parseImmutable与JSON.parse()类似,但返回记录而非对象,返回元组而非数组(递归)。 未来:类实例会按值比较吗? 相比对象和数组,我其实更喜欢使用类作为一个数据容器。

    66631

    PG 向量化引擎--2

    关于设计中几个问题 1、vtype中使用原生数组而不是Datum数组会更有效吗?...所以使用原生数据可以只做一个memcpy来填充vtypebatch。 2、为什么VectorTupleSlot中包含元组数据(batch)而不是向量(vtype数组)?...当然,我们也可以使用单独字段来存储vtypes 其次,VectorTupleSlot还包含堆元组数据。这属于堆元组变形。事实上,一个batch中包含元组可能跨多个页。...因此我们需要pin住相关页数组,而不仅仅是一个页 3、为什么必须实现子集plan_tree_mutator而不是使用expression_tree_mutator?...我VOPS中做了类似测试,发现大于128大小并没有带来显著性能提升。你当前使用batch大小是1024,明显大于一页上元组数量。

    88620

    每周学点大数据 | No.37字数统计

    Map 函数将一个文档打开,每遇到一个单词,就发送 这样一个元组。...小可:这个改进版本多了一个数组 H,可以对单词 t 进行内部统计,输出结果之前,将相同单词在这篇文章里出现次数进行了合并。...不难发现,对于一个单词 t 最终还是发出多条记录,当文档非常多时,发出记录也就非常多,这对于通信来说依然会造成很大力。 所以我们还要继续改进: ? Mr....Mapper 把数组声明成了一个全局量, Mapper 在其整个运行过程中,不论它在处理哪一个文档,都能访问到这个数组。...也就是说, Mapper 运行过程中,只要对应一个单词,不论来自哪一个文档,都可以将其加入到单词在数组频度记录中去,这就实现了 Mapper 在其处理所有文档中对单词统计量合并。

    878120

    Python 面试问答 Top 25

    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8) 数组元组之间区别是什么? 数组元组之间区别是数组内容是可以被修改元组内容是只读。...匿名函数lambda没有语句原因是它被用于代码被执行时候构建新函数对象并且返回。 15)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 19)Python中什么是生成器? 生成器是实现迭代器一种机制。... Python 中文档字符串被称为docstring,它被用于Python中为函数,模块和类注释生成文档。 21) Python中如何拷贝一个对象?...24) Xrange和range区别是什么? Xrange返回一个xrange对象,而range返回一个数组。不管那个范围多大,Xrange使用同样内存。

    98430

    Python 面试问答 Top 25

    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8) 数组元组之间区别是什么? 数组元组之间区别是数组内容是可以被修改元组内容是只读。...匿名函数lambda没有语句原因是它被用于代码被执行时候构建新函数对象并且返回。 15)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 19)Python中什么是生成器? 生成器是实现迭代器一种机制。... Python 中文档字符串被称为docstring,它被用于Python中为函数,模块和类注释生成文档。 21) Python中如何拷贝一个对象?...24) Xrange和range区别是什么? Xrange返回一个xrange对象,而range返回一个数组。不管那个范围多大,Xrange使用同样内存。

    92030

    常见25个python面试问答

    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8.数组元组之间区别是什么? 数组元组之间区别:数组内容是可以被修改,而元组内容是只读。...13.Python中lambda是什么? 这是一个常被用于代码中单个表达式匿名函数。 14.为什么lambda没有语句?...匿名函数lambda没有语句原因,是它被用于代码被执行时候构建新函数对象并且返回。 15.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 ? 19.Python中什么是构造器? 生成器是实现迭代器一种机制。...24.Xrange和range区别是什么? Xrange用于返回一个xrange对象,而range用于返回一个数组。不管那个范围多大,Xrange都使用同样内存。

    1K11

    流畅 Python 第二版(GPT 重译)(一)

    Python 对象一个基本要求是提供自身可用字符串表示,一个用于调试和日志记录,另一个用于呈现给终端用户。这就是为什么数据模型中存在特殊方法 __repr__ 和 __str__ 原因。...这就是为什么一个浮点数组一个浮点元组更紧凑:数组一个单一对象,包含浮点数原始值,而元组由多个对象组成——元组本身和其中包含每个float对象。...元组作为记录 元组保存记录元组每一项保存一个字段数据,项目的位置赋予了含义。 如果将元组视为不可变列表,则根据上下文,项目的数量和顺序可能重要,也可能不重要。...但是元组用作字段集合时,项目的数量通常是固定,它们顺序始终很重要。 示例 2-7 显示了用作记录元组。...返回None以提醒我们改变了接收者¹¹,并且没有创建新列表。这是一个重要 Python API 约定:原地更改对象函数或方法应该返回None,以明确告诉调用者接收者已被更改,没有创建新对象。

    23100

    Python 面试问答 Top 25

    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8) 数组元组之间区别是什么? 数组元组之间区别是数组内容是可以被修改元组内容是只读。...匿名函数lambda没有语句原因是它被用于代码被执行时候构建新函数对象并且返回。 15)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 19)Python中什么是生成器? 生成器是实现迭代器一种机制。... Python 中文档字符串被称为docstring,它被用于Python中为函数,模块和类注释生成文档。 21) Python中如何拷贝一个对象?...24) Xrange和range区别是什么? Xrange返回一个xrange对象,而range返回一个数组。不管那个范围多大,Xrange使用同样内存。

    99360

    Python 面试问答 Top 25

    Python装饰器是Python中特有变动,可以使修改函数变得更容易。 8) 数组元组之间区别是什么? 数组元组之间区别是数组内容是可以被修改元组内容是只读。...匿名函数lambda没有语句原因是它被用于代码被执行时候构建新函数对象并且返回。 15) Python中pass是什么? Pass是一个Python中不会被执行语句。...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 19)Python中什么是生成器? 生成器是实现迭代器一种机制。... Python 中文档字符串被称为docstring,它被用于Python中为函数,模块和类注释生成文档。 21) Python中如何拷贝一个对象?...24) Xrange和range区别是什么? Xrange返回一个xrange对象,而range返回一个数组。不管那个范围多大,Xrange使用同样内存。

    76150

    干货|分析PostgreSql单表60w数据却占用55g空间

    突然听到运维说磁盘预发布环境磁盘空间不够,细查之下发现是由于某个表数据太大导致,但是查看了下数据库表发现,实际表数据量只有60w条,很明显表哪里出问题了,一开始以为是犹豫表设计不合理索引导致数据量大...正在焦虑蹉跎时候,有幸得到朋友圈大佬指点,是死亡元组太多导致只需要执行vacuum full清理死亡元组就好,查看了相关博客稳定发现postgresql居然会保存mvcc多版本修改记录,简单理解就是...恢复磁盘空间 PostgreSQL中,一次行UPDATE或DELETE不会立即移除该行旧版本。...恢复磁盘空间](http://www.postgres.cn/docs/10/routine-vacuuming.html)这就解释了为什么一个表明明只有60w数据却空间占用55g,一条记录被更新之后他快照依然会保留...vacuum full来代替vacuum毕竟,况且使用vacuum full会锁住整个表,之前预发布环境中,也整整执行了6分钟,这是非常不理想,万一用户使用呢这就很不友好了,况且版本记录有时候还是有用

    79250

    27 个问题,告诉你Python为什么这么设计

    看到豌豆花下猫 Python 猫公众号推这篇文章,虽说是从文档里节选,但是对深入学习Python很有价值,也推荐给大家。 文章选自 Python 官方文档。...一个是性能:知道字符串是不可变,意味着我们可以创建时为分配空间,并且存储需求是固定不变。这也是元组和列表之间区别的原因之一。 另一个优点是,Python 中字符串被视为与数字一样“基本”。...虽然列表和元组许多方面是相似的,但它们使用方式通常是完全不同。可以认为元组类似于Pascal记录或C结构;它们是相关数据小集合,可以是不同类型数据,可以作为一个组进行操作。...返回表示当前目录中文件字符串列表。如果向目录中添加了一两个文件,对此输出进行操作函数通常不会中断。 元组是不可变,这意味着一旦创建了元组,就不能用新值替换任何元素。...如果你尝试查找旧值,也不会找到,因为该哈希表中找到对象值会有所不同。 如果你想要一个用列表索引字典,只需先将列表转换为元组;用函数 tuple(L) 创建一个元组,其条目与列表 L相同。

    6.7K11

    NumPy 秘籍中文第二版:六、特殊数组和通用函数

    提供了一些向量化字符串操作以及有关空格便捷行为。 另见 chararray类文档 创建遮罩数组 遮罩数组可用于忽略丢失或无效数据项。...另见 numpy.ma模块文档 忽略负值和极值 当我们想忽略负值时,例如当取数组对数时,屏蔽数组很有用。 遮罩数组一个用例是排除极值。 这基于极限值上限和下限。...另见 numpy.ma模块文档 使用recarray函数创建得分表 recarray类是ndarray子类。 这些数组可以像数据库中一样保存记录,具有不同数据类型。...操作步骤 让我们从创建记录数组开始: 为每个记录创建一个包含符号,标准差得分,平均得分和总得分记录数组: weights = np.recarray((len(tickers),), dtype=[(...记录数组使我们可以将字段作为数组成员访问,例如arr.field。 本教程介绍了记录数组创建。 您可以numpy.recarray模块中找到更多与记录数组相关功能。

    57010

    Python面试突击

    Pylint是检验模块是否达到代码标准一个工具。 什么是Python装饰器? Python装饰器是Python中特有变动,可以使修改函数变得更容易。 数组元组之间区别是什么?...数组元组之间区别:数组内容是可以被修改,而元组内容是只读。另外,元组可以被哈希,比如作为字典关键字。 参数按值传递和引用传递是怎样实现?...Python中什么是slicing? * Slicing是一种在有序对象类型中(数组元组,字符串)节选某一段语法。 Python中什么是构造器? * 生成器是实现迭代器一种机制。...* Python中文档字符串被称为docstring,它在Python中作用是为函数、模块和类注释生成文档。 如何在Python中拷贝一个对象?...如何将一个数字转换成一个字符串? Xrange和range区别是什么? * Xrange用于返回一个xrange对象,而range用于返回一个数组。不管那个范围多大,Xrange都使用同样内存。

    1.6K41

    数据类型· 第1篇《元组和列表性能分析、命名元组

    目录 一、元组和列表 1.元组和列表性能分析 2.为什么列表 Python 中是最常用呢?...元组和列表内存占用对比图 用一个列表存储 50 条数据和用一个元组存储 50 条数据,那么元组占用内存要比列表小得多。 2.为什么列表 Python 中是最常用呢?...元组、列表使用时候,都是通过下标索引取值。 下标索引取值不太人性化,如果我知道数据储存在元组里面,但是我不知道具体储存下标位置。...设定命名元组类型时候,返回这个对象里面只包含了传进去这几个名字。 接下来,要创建命名元组时候,元素和它一样多,名字和对应元素值是一一对应,不能多,不能少。 否则就会报错: ?...print(type(tu)) # 看下类型 ? ? 返回对象和类型名用一个名字。 print(type(student_info)) ?

    59040

    Python基础之序列构成数组

    本文重点: 1、了解列表、元组、字节序列、数组等数据结构; 2、了解上述数据结构相对应迭代、切片、排序、拼接操作; 3、如果想把代码写Pythonic,保证代码可读性前提下,代码行数越少越好。...元组有两重功能,一是当作记录来用数据模型,二是充当不可变列表, 1、用作记录元组用作记录时,可以理解为数据+位置。...接受任何形式可迭代对象作为参数,返回一个列表。 两者都有两个参数供选择。一是reverse,默认False升序排列,设定为True会降序输出;二是key,设置比较关键字参数。...(haystack,needle):返回一个haystack中插入needle保持序列升序位置。...bisect.insort(seq,item):返回一个seq中插入item保持序列升序新序列。

    1.1K10
    领券